> On Fri, 2004-04-09 at 12:58, Tom Lord wrote:
>> The problem is that a program like `tar' is going to non-atomicly
>> traverse the tree. That means that at time T it's going to "take a
>> snapshot" of some part of the archive tree and at time T+1 it'll take
>> a snapshot of some other part of the archive tree. tar makes no
>> guarantee about the ordering of scope of those snapshots.
>
> Pity more people don't use something akin to LVM snapshotting to
> guarantee that their backups are based off a state guaranteed to have
> existed at some point in time.
(Evil grin)
People that have public archives already have a live backup --
http://mirrors.gnuarch.org/(archivename)
